Abstract

We have developed a line-based computer control system that is embedded within the commercially available program LabVIEW. The program translates a sequence of C++ commands into an array of values for the programming of hardware devices, including digital and analog I/O boards and a GPIB controller. These commands are executed with 1 μs resolution upon receipt of an external triggering signal. We have successfully applied this system to the generation of Bose–Einstein condensates in a dilute gas of Rb87.
